beatdown to be televizzled
our game against the midshipmen will be televised on cbs college sports. it's a channel i don't subscribe to but one of the things i like about our local insight cable is whenever a wku game is televised on an offshoot channel like that or espn the ocho, insight will make that channel available.

although i predict a beatdown of epic proportions i will be in front of the 52" sharp aquos watching it in living color. if only so i will have something to beat eLLLLLLLLLLLson down with this week.

i really like playing the service academies. i especially like playing navy as not all of those players will end up being squid officers. many of them will end up as marine officers and god only knows we need more of them with what is going on in the world.

i watched them play ohio state and they gave them everything they wanted. they also played pitt a good game on the road. it's a tough offense to prepare for as you may only see it one time a year.

i heard a stat and don't know if it's true but they said that the 2 lowest penalized teams in 1a last year were army and navy. i thought that was pretty cool. think 'discipline' has anything to do with that???

i would love a win. i WANT eLLLLLLLLLLLson to be successful. after watching our first three games, i just don't see it remotely happening. eLLLLLLLLLLLson has had us on a downhill slide since he took over. it's been progressively worse long before we became 1a. he talks a good talk. says all of the right things but so far he hasn't been able to back it up.

gametime is 2:30 p.m. cdt.

final score 38-22 navy.

our offense clicked better than it has all year mainly due to the q.b. the o-line played better but still had way too many penalties and allowed navy to get pressure on the q.b. without sending anybody.

our defense was embarrassing. eLLLLLLLLLLLLson still believes in the 3-4 but it doesn't appear he has the horses to play it. that one is on him.

we're still staring straight down the barrell at 0-12. especially since eLLLLLLLLLLLLson has looked like a monkey screwin' a football in the past when it came to q.b. controversy.

he has one now. he said all week long that if brandon smith were healthy he's the starting q.b. let's see if he sticks with that after the game that jakes just had.

this is a big 6'3 q.b. that can make all of the throws. brandon is a great kid but barely 6' on a good day and does not have the arm to make the throws. he's tough as nails and will give up his body but he is nowhere near the player that jakes is.

losing streak is now at 12 straight. we play bye next week so that gives us time to heal up any injuries. clendenen's replacement at nose tackle got killed. hopefully clendenen will be back by the time we play fiu.
